最新回答 / JUNzx
测试类继承了UnitTestBase测试基类,测试基类中有两个getBean方法,分别封装了容器的两个getBean方法获取Bean的过程,所以测试类中的super.getBean就是相应的调用父类中的那两个封装好的getBean方法,应该是这样子。
2018-09-15
最赞回答 / juaining
在不改变对象和类的代码的前提下,为对象和类添加新的方法。具体可以参考下:https://www.jianshu.com/p/d1363a376ae8
2018-09-13
最新回答 / 慕运维8403812
我的理解是。所谓自动装配,指的其实就是对象和变量的组合,或者说就是对变量自动赋值,可以用@Autowired去标记变量方法来实现自动装配,而@Autowired可以用在构造中,set方法中,为什么有这么多的,其实主要还是为了适应更多的应用场景。而自动装配涉及到两步:创建对象(使用@Configuration、@Bean等)对象赋值给指定变量(使用@Autowired、@Inject等)
2018-09-09
最新回答 / 慕沐7199068
已解决:<...图片...>
最赞回答 / 慕娘6527991
看你的springxml配置好像是spring-beanannatation.xml, 但是在你的实体类StringStore中没用注解,你是用的XML配置的方式吗?如果是的话,那么问题就在XML中,你可能只声明了Init-method方法,所以注释会出错。但是没配置destroy-method,所以注不住释都不出错。